Landscape architect, city planner. Helen Elise Bullard, was born in Schuylerville,
New York on June 28, 1896, the daughter of Dr. Thomas E. Bullard and Elizabeth Huggins
Bullard. She attended the Schuylerville Public School. She graduated from Cornell
University with a Bachelor in Science Degree in Landscape Architecture (then Landscape
Art) from the College of Agriculture. She was employed by the Wagner Park Nursery
Company at Sidney, Ohio (not verified) where she lectured and advised on Small Home
Grounds. From 1921 to 1925 she worked in the office of Warren H. Manning, Boston,
Massachusetts as the plantsman and planting designer and supervisor of projects. She
worked on both private estates and community pageants. By 1929 she was employed in
the office of Annette Hoyt Flanders and supervised a number of estate projects, primarily
on Long Island. In 1930 she was employed by the New York State government. She began
in the Civil service, performing projects for the Long Island State Park Commission,
Rye Beach Park, and the Southern State Parkway. In 1937 she was assigned as a Landscape
Architect for the New York World's Fair, 1939. She was named Junior Landscape Architect
for the New York State Department of Public Works in 1938 and remained there until
she retired in 1964. During her career she lectured on gardening, garden design, city
planning, and housing issues. She died in Schuylerville, New York on November 4, 1987.
The collection contains original files of H.E. Bullard containing both personal correspondence
and memorabilia (music programs, tax records, and Sunday school materials) and professional
project papers and blueprints. These papers include: journals from her courses at
Cornell University from 1915 to 1918; blueprints and correspondence related to her
work in the offices of Warren H. Manning (1921-1925) and Annette Hoyt Flanders (1929);
an extensive collection of clippings from contemporary professional and lay magazines
and journals as well as travel brochures from the western United States and the Paris
Expo 1937; documents from her work as Landscape Designer at the New York State World's
Fair, 1939; lecture notes on city planning, housing, garden design, and victory gardens;
drawings from projects including work with the C.C.C. on parkways.
